Ronny delicious father reveals now that the son already two weeks ago took the decision that the time Celtic manager was over.

Wednesday confirmed Celtic that the team agrees with Ronny Deila to terminate the Norwegian’s working. Telemark continues as CEO this year’s season – and will probably be able to celebrate their second straight league title with the Scottish big club.

Then he goes home. In an interview with the Scottish big newspaper Daily Record admits delicious father Arne that he is relieved his son’s decision – and he for some time have known what was afoot.

– It was his own decision to quit. He told me a while ago that he was thinking about it. There are a few weeks ago, says Arne Deila.

– The decision feels good. The pressure in his job has been enormous, and I am delighted that Ron can now relax again after these two years, he added.

Sunday he sat in the stands and saw his son Celtic crew knocked out of the Cup against archrival Rangers after penalty shootout. After the game had father and son Deila a private dinner, where the future was discussed.

– I’d rather not say too much about what we discussed, but I feel sorry for him. I could read it in his face and expression in recent months have not been the way it should be, says Arne Deila.



Irritated at fans

From stands concluded Arne Deila with the cup game against Rangers as well be ended with a win for Celtic. It did not, and after the game he met a coach who is in pain.

– Ron was obviously not very happy after the game. He was very angry at himself and the team that it was not final, he said.

Deila senior has also not much left over for the part of the Celtic supporters who whistled against son layers than to show their support.

– Some people irritate me. They support not made the way they should. It is demanding, and finally being pushed too high, he said.

Now, he hopes his son grants some well deserved vacation days after the season is over.
